Sangoma Careers

    1. QA Testing Engineer (2010-03-11)

    Sangoma is the premium provider of voice and data connectivity components for software-based communication applications. Sangoma's data cards, voice cards, gateways and connectivity software are used in leading PBX, IVR, Contact Center and data communication applications worldwide. The product line represents a comprehensive toolset for deploying cost-effective, powerful, and flexible software communication applications.

    Founded in 1984, Sangoma Technologies Corporation is publicly traded on the TSX Venture Exchange (TSX VENTURE:STC). Additional information on Sangoma can be found at: www.sangoma.com.

    Please forward all resumes to:  humanresources@sangoma.com


     

    QA/Testing Engineer


    We currently have an opening for a QA/Testing Engineer who must be first and foremost a great cultural fit. The right candidate will be eager and quick to learn new technologies, will thrive in a fast-paced environment, and be willing to pick up the slack and help wherever needed.


    JOB STATUS
    : OPEN (2010-03-11)

    JOB DESCRIPTION

    Sangoma is looking for a talented, self motivated QA software engineer to join our fast paced, ever growing organization. The successful candidate will join our QA team and will have opportunity to learn and work with the latest Sangoma’s VoIP and WAN technologies. Responsibilities will also include QA testing, QA procedures, automated regression testing development.

    DEGREE

    Bachelor in Computer Engineering

    ROLE

    • QA Testing
    • QA Regression Testing Development (Linux & Windows)
    • QA Procedures
    • Linux/Windows Application Development, Scripting and Maintenance

    REQUIRED SKILLS

    • QA Testing Skills
    • Regression Testing Suites
    • Design of QA procedure and systems
    • Willingness/ability to learn in a fast-paced environment
    • Self-starter, motivated and ability to learn quickly
    • Programming Languages: C, Perl, Shell (C++ and Shell scripting an asset).
    • Knowledge of Linux (Install/setup/drivers an asset)
    • Knowledge of Routing and Computer Networks, including IP/WAN Networking

     

    ADDITIONAL SKILLS

    • Socket Programming Skills
    • Experience in VoIP and Telephony Systems
    • Experience with Asterisk® and or FreeSwitch Software-based PBX
    • Knowledge of Networking Protocol Stacks: PPP, Frame Relay, CHDLC, ATM

     

     

     



     

    Junior Technical Support Engineer

     

    We currently have an opening for a Junior Technical Support Engineer who must be first and foremost a great cultural fit. The right candidate will be eager and quick to learn new technologies, will thrive in a fast-paced environment, and be willing to pick up the slack and help wherever needed.

     

    JOB STATUS: CLOSED 

    Essential Duties and Responsibilities

    Some duties you will be tasked with:

    • 1st and 2nd Level Technical Support – VoIP (Asterisk®), WAN/IP Networking
    • Quality Assurance Testing
    • Linux/BSD Application scripting and maintenance
    • WAN Protocol support and maintenance

    Knowledge, Skills and Abilities

    • Eager and quick to learn new technologies
    • A self starter who is highly motivated
    • An excellent oral communicator with a strong grasp of the English language

    Required Software Skills:

    • Programming languages: C, (C++ and Shell scripting an asset)
    • Knowledge of Linux (install/setup/drivers an asset)
    • Knowledge of routing and computer networks including IP/WAN networking

    Additional Skills:

    • Knowledge of networking protocol stacks: PPP, Frame Relay, CHDLC, ATM
    • Socket programming skills
    • Experience with VoIP and telephony systems
    • Experience with Asterisk® Software based PBX
    • Perl scripting
    • Linux driver/kernel module development

    Whatever your combined skill set, be prepared to demonstrate it.

    Required Education:

    • Undergraduate Degree or Diploma in IT

    Years Experience:

    • 0-2